So you are already planning F28 and F29 schedules when we do not even know
whether the F27 schedule can be kept even remotely. To me, the F27 schedule
looks completely unrealistic, with less than 3 months (!) between the F26
release and the F27 Final Freeze! That's pretty much a halved cycle.
IMHO, if you absolutely want to stick to May/October dates, it may make
sense to skip a release date as was done with F21 and go for a 9-month
cycle. The schedule as it stands now either WILL slip, or almost all the
planned features WILL have to be punted (and F27 will be essentially
identical to F26).
